Age-specific morbidity among Navy pilots.

A Hoiberg, C Blood

    Aviation, Space, and Environmental Medicine
    |October 1, 1983
    PubMed
    Summary

    Male Navy pilots and aircrew exhibit higher hospitalization rates than other officers. Younger pilots face risks from dental issues and sports injuries, while older pilots show higher rates of circulatory diseases. Developing health risk profiles can improve Navy personnel health.

    Area of Science:

    • Aerospace Medicine
    • Occupational Health
    • Preventive Medicine

    Background:

    • Military aviators and officers represent distinct occupational groups with varying health demands.
    • Understanding hospitalization patterns is crucial for targeted health interventions within military populations.
    • Previous research has not comprehensively compared hospitalization rates across diverse officer roles in the Navy.

    Purpose of the Study:

    • To compare hospitalization (morbidity) rates by age among male Navy aviators and three control officer groups.
    • To identify specific diagnostic categories contributing to elevated hospitalization rates in aviators.
    • To inform the development of health risk profiles for Navy personnel.

    Main Methods:

    • Retrospective cohort study comparing hospitalization data.
    • Analysis of male Navy aviators (n=22,417) against nonpilot aircrew officers (n=9,483), unrestricted line officers (n=55,593), and staff officers (n=46,565).
    • Age-stratified comparison of total admissions and 16 major diagnostic categories.

    Main Results:

    • Aircrew members and pilots demonstrated the highest hospitalization rates across total admissions and most diagnostic categories.
    • Younger pilots had elevated rates for dental disorders and accidental (sports-related) injuries.
    • Older pilots showed a higher incidence of circulatory diseases compared to control groups.
    • All four officer populations exhibited lower hospitalization rates than general civilian populations.

    Conclusions:

    • Navy aviators and aircrew experience higher morbidity rates, necessitating focused health surveillance.
    • Specific age-related health risks, including dental, injury, and circulatory issues, are identified in pilots.
    • Implementing a health risk profile system is recommended to proactively manage and reduce health risks for Navy personnel.
